SQL 5 Errors ...

Wichtiger Hinweis: Bitte ändert nicht manuell die Schriftfarbe auf schwarz sondern belasst es bei der Standardeinstellung. Somit tragt ihr dazu bei dass euer Text auch bei Verwendung unseren dunklen Forenstils noch lesbar ist!

Tipp: Ihr wollt längere Codeausschnitte oder Logfiles bereitstellen? Benutzt unseren eigenen PasteBin-Dienst Link
  • Guten Tag,
    ich hab ein Problem mit meinem Script,
    ich bekomme dauernd 5 Errors ... Die einfach nicht weggehen und
    ich keine Ahnung hab, was da falsch sein könnte.



    (9) : error 035: argument type mismatch (argument 2)
    (5) : warning 203: symbol is never used: "MySQLHandler"
    17) : warning 236: unknown parameter in substitution (incorrect #define pattern)
    (17) : warning 236: unknown parameter in substitution (incorrect #define pattern)
    (17) : warning 236: unknown parameter in substitution (incorrect #define pattern)
    (17) : warning 236: unknown parameter in substitution (incorrect #define pattern)
    (17) : warning 236: unknown parameter in substitution (incorrect #define pattern)
    (17) : warning 236: unknown parameter in substitution (incorrect #define pattern)
    (17) : warning 236: unknown parameter in substitution (incorrect #define pattern)
    (17) : error 029: invalid expression, assumed zero
    (17) : warning 215: expression has no effect
    (17) : error 029: invalid expression, assumed zero
    (17) : warning 215: expression has no effect
    (17) : error 029: invalid expression, assumed zero
    (17) : fatal error 107: too many error messages on one line



    Zeile 17:



    }
    stock getGid(pName[])
    {
    new ret[128], str[256];
    format(str, sizeof str, "SELECT `userID` FROM `%s` WHERE `username` = '%s';", wcf_user, pName);
    [color=#ff0000]ZEILE 17 ->>> [/color] mysql_query(str, (-1), (-1), MySQLConnections[3]);
    mysql_store_result(MySQLConnections[3]);
    if(mysql_num_rows(MySQLConnections[3]))
    {
    mysql_fetch_row(str, MySQLConnections[3]);
    mysql_fetch_field_row(ret, "userID", MySQLConnections[3]);
    }
    mysql_free_result(MySQLConnections[3]);
    if(strval(ret) < 1 || strval(ret) > 999999)
    return -1;
    return strval(ret);
    }


    Zeile 9:


    new value[256];


    [color=#ff0000]ZEILE 9 ->>> [/color]mysql_get_field(string, value, MySQLHandler);


    return value;




    Ich benutze das MySQL R7 von BlueG.

    Einmal editiert, zuletzt von seegras ()